Study Subject (s): Scholarships are awarded to undertake the joint University of Edinburgh/RCPE MSc in Internal Medicine.
Course Level: Scholarships are available for pursuing part-time, by distance learning master’s degree level.

Scholarship Description: Applications are invited for UK and International Scholarships for the academic year 2015-2016. Scholarships are awarded to undertake the joint University of Edinburgh/RCPE MSc in Internal Medicine. Seven scholarships available: one full scholarship for the citizens of an eligible Sub-Saharan African country, four 75% scholarships for citizens of a DfID priority country and two 50% Scholarships for resident in the UK or any country not in the DfID list will be awarded. The deadline for scholarship applications for 2015 entry is 30 June 2015.

RCPE Scholarships aim to enable talented doctors to undertake the joint University of Edinburgh/RCPE MSc in Internal Medicine, part-time, by distance learning. Seven scholarships were awarded for entry in 2013 and eight in 2014.

Eligibility:
-To apply applicants must:
-Be self-funding (support from friends and relatives is acceptable)
-Be a resident citizen in a qualifying country
-For the full and 75% scholarships – not have studied in a developed country previously (though applicants who have are welcome to apply for the 50% scholarships)
-Have been accepted onto the MSc

Eligible Group: Eligible countries in Sub-Saharan African country are those also listed in the DfID priority list: Congo (Democratic Republic of), Eritrea, Ethiopia, Ghana, Kenya, Liberia, Malawi, Mozambique, Nigeria, Rwanda, Sierra Leone, Somalia, South Africa, South Sudan, Sudan, Tanzania, Uganda, Zambia, Zimbabwe and countries on the DfID priority list: Afghanistan, Bangladesh, Burma, Democratic Republic of Congo, Ethiopia, Ghana, India, Kenya, Kyrgyz Republic, Liberia, Malawi, Mozambique, Nepal, Nigeria, Occupied Palestinian Territories, Pakistan, Rwanda, Sierra Leone, Somalia, South Africa, South Sudan, Sudan, Tajikistan, Tanzania, Uganda, Yemen, Zambia and Zimbabwe and who are resident in the UK or any country not in the DfID list can apply for these scholarships.

How to Apply: The mode of applying is online.

Scholarship Application Deadline: The deadline for scholarship applications for 2015 entry is 30 June 2015.
